# Get Project Param

Gets the selected Project Parameter.

### Parameters

* **Parameter** - The parameter to be obtained. if can be one of:
  * Android Google App Key
  * Android Google App ID
  * Android Google Project ID
  * Android Sender ID
  * Currency Decimal Places
  * Currency Symbol
  * Decimal Separator
  * Enable Push Notifications
  * Hide Navigation Bar
  * Idle Time
  * MIS Product Code
  * Prevent automatic Keyboard display
  * Save messages when application is not active
  * Thousand Separator
  * Database Encryption Key
* **Target** - Control or variable to save the specified parameter.

{% hint style="info" %}
The Project and Database versions from Linked Projects can also be retrieved with this action.
